What does Manvith mean?

Manvith is a Sanskrit name derived from the root word 'manas' meaning mind or intellect. It is also believed to be the name of the first creator of the universe in Hindu mythology.

Spiritual & cultural context

Symbolizes wisdom and knowledge.

The name Manvith carries significant cultural importance as it is considered a unique and respectable name among Hindus. It highlights the intelligence and wisdom of a person, suggesting that they possess a profound and thoughtful outlook on life. This name is highly regarded in both traditional and contemporary Indian society.
